Go语言构建弹性云计算架构:高效计算与动态资源调配

Go语言凭借其简洁的语法和高效的并发模型,成为构建弹性云计算架构的理想选择。在云环境中,系统需要处理大量并发请求,并根据负载动态调整资源,Go的goroutine机制能够高效地管理这些任务。

弹性云计算的核心在于动态资源调配,Go语言通过内置的调度器实现轻量级线程的高效切换,使得应用能够在不同负载下快速响应。这种特性让Go在微服务架构中表现出色,尤其适合需要高可用性和可扩展性的场景。

在实际部署中,Go语言常与容器化技术如Docker结合使用,配合Kubernetes等编排工具,实现自动化的资源分配和故障恢复。这种组合不仅提升了系统的稳定性,也降低了运维成本。

与此同时,Go语言的标准库提供了丰富的网络和并发支持,开发者可以快速构建高性能的云原生应用。例如,使用gRPC或HTTP/2协议,能够有效提升服务间的通信效率。

AI生成的趋势图,仅供参考

随着云原生技术的发展,Go语言在弹性计算领域的应用不断深化。它不仅提升了系统的响应速度,还为资源的智能调度提供了坚实的基础,推动了云计算向更高效、更灵活的方向演进。

dawei

【声明】:唐山站长网内容转载自互联网,其相关言论仅代表作者个人观点绝非权威,不代表本站立场。如您发现内容存在版权问题,请提交相关链接至邮箱:bqsm@foxmail.com,我们将及时予以处理。

发表回复